Phone number ☎️ 02036083056 👆 is reported as a persistent scam phone number falsely claiming to be from BT’s technical support. Callers typically allege urgent issues with your router or internet security, pressuring recipients to grant remote access via sites like TeamViewer. The scammers often feature Indian accents, provide fake engineer names, and attempt to verify legitimacy by giving this number for callback, which only reveals the fraud. Many targets have been asked for sensitive information or to allow control over their computers, causing significant alarm. Users strongly advise against engaging, sharing personal details, or allowing remote access. Always verify independently through official BT contact channels and remain vigilant, especially if updates or engineer visits are unsolicited. Authorities recommend reporting such calls to prevent further victimisation.

About 02 Numbers
These numbers correspond to specific locations in the UK and are widely used by domestic and commercial premises. Often called as 'basic rate', 'local rate', or 'national rate' numbers, the call costs for these geographic numbers are predicated on the time of day. Several service providers offer call packages that allow free calls during certain times. Call costs from mobile phones are subject to the chosen calling plan, with a number of plans including these numbers in their free call packages.
